Giant Slingshot: New Way To Space?

"All space projects get into orbit pretty much the same way â€" by burning lots of rocket fuel, a spaceship powers itself past the sky. But what if there was a different approach? What if we could throw something so hard, it would wind up in space? At NASA's behest, Ed Schmidt and Mark Bundy of the Army Research Lab are looking at ways of firing projectiles into orbit." - Defense Tech
